Philosophy, Mission and Program Outcomes

Purpose 

The program is designed to prepare graduates for additional career opportunities and advancement within the health care informatics profession. 

  

Mission 

The program for the Bachelor of Science in Health Care Business with a major in Informatics provides a learning environment that encompasses computer information technology and applies it to the medical field. The program is designed to develop knowledge, leadership and technical skills so that individuals can advance in business and health care environments. The PACS certificate courses compliment the Bachelor degree coursework.    

  

Program Outcomes 

Upon completion of the program, the student will be able to: 

·    demonstrate professional, responsible and technical abilities as business professional for health care agencies, both in traditional and non-traditional settings. 

·    demonstrate professional verbal and written communication skills when interacting with colleagues, and health care providers and the public. 

·    examine theoretical knowledge and analytical abilities necessary to be prepared for a professional business informatics position in the health care setting.  

·    identify system problems when dealing with an informatics system based on theories learned in the curriculum and externship experiences.  

·    practice cultural, economic, ethical, legal and professional standards along with responsible use of resource utilization in an informatics administrator or management role.  

  

Philosophy 

The overall success of the graduate is based on progressive integration of the curriculum and is followed with practical experience through the Mission of the College. Selection of coursework is based on the experience and background of the individual to ensure students can apply the knowledge that they may already have, and build on that foundation if so desired. Traditional students, as well as distance students, can achieve this business knowledge through an interactive and motivational on-line learning environment.
